I have a 1991 K1500 chevrolet with a 5.7 350 in it. i am about to install a 3inch body lift and a 2inch leveling kit for the front end so the 10,000lbs winch wont make it sag. I am needing advice on tires and what size i can fit and should use. i am considering super swamper boggers or super swamper sx/tsl. i believe that 33 inch is the tallest i can go. it will be a 98% offroad and 2% on road truck. just enough time on the road to get to the trail or mud hole

i went through the same process when i got my truck 2001. I went with the body lift 1st, then wanted higher ground clearance. You might save a lot of money if you go ahead with a suspension lift and run 35". changing tire size coast close to a grand each time. if you gonna do all playn with this truck you will wont more lift after a few times on the trail or mud-pit.
back to tires, i have been mudding with friends who ran super swampers and i had BFG Muds and we ran neck and neck, the good thing is my BFG's lasted longer and when they got a little worn they didnt sound near as bad as swampers did. in the last 8yers i have had 4 different style tires and the BFG muds rocked!!!! maybe BFG will give me discount for advertisment....lol have fun bro

i would stay away from the boggers on your truck. they will destroy the ifs. a buddy of mine just put a set of 33 boggers on his half ton and the first time he had it out it broke both the half shafts. i would go with a little less agressive tire like the wranglers or mickey tompson baja mtz's
